There’s always something to do and somewhere to go in Richmond. With the unique Georgian Theatre Royal plus the award-winning independent cinema at The Station, drama and cinema are well taken care of, and then there’s the sparkling events programme at the Green Howards Museum, as well as Richmond Castle and the Richmondshire Museum.

And coming up is Richmond MayFest - the town's annual celebration of spring with loads of music, dance and family fun going on all over the town. This year it is all happening on May 2nd-May 4th, with the May Fair at Richmond Castle, concerts, ceilidh, Folk Fest, Baroque Fest, Day of Dance and much much more. Stained Glass Tulip Workshop

Make a stained glass tulip with Anne, who has over 30 years of experience in the art of stained glass. You will learn how to cut, shape, grind, copper foil, and solder glass, and take home your creation. Anne will provide a template, which you can adapt if you wish using the different coloured glass provided. Depending on working speed, there may be time to make more than one tulip during the session.

All are welcome* - from the absolute beginner to the more experienced.

£60 per person - all materials provided.

*Please note this workshop is only suitable for those aged 16 or over
